Level 2 Diploma in Fashion Retail
The Level 2 Diploma course is designed to prepare you for entry to the fashion retail industry or for further education, either within the Fashion Retail Academy or at other Further Education colleges. The aim of the course is to build on your communication skills and develop them within a fashion retail context.
For entry to the Level 2 Diploma, you should:
• be at least 16 by 1st September in the year of entry
• show motivation to succeed on the course
• demonstrate an aptitude and enthusiasm for fashion retail
No formal entry requirements are required for this diploma course
Selection Process
To assess your suitability for the Level 2 Diploma course, you will be invited to the Academy where one or more members of the course team will interview you. This will allow us to gain a good idea of your self motivation and commitment. It will also give you an opportunity to ask questions about the course.
Structure
You’ll work on understanding the principles of fashion retail as well as developing critical observation skills. We’ll help you develop research and writing skills, and give you insights into the many roles in the fashion retail industry. You’ll also gain a grasp of the language and terms used both within the sector and in the marketing and media associated with it.
Throughout the course we’ll encourage you to build up your knowledge as well as develop presentation skills to help with future work/ course applications. To achieve the Level 2 Diploma qualification candidates must complete all the units listed opposite:
Core Units
• Customer Service and Selling for Fashion Retail
• The Fashion Retail Marketplace
• Technology for Fashion Retail
• Business of Fashion Retail
• Introduction to Visual Merchandising
• Introduction to Buying and Merchandising for Fashion Retail
• Professional Development in Retail
• Personal Shopping and Style
• Fashion History and Culture
• Fashion Design and Communication
• Understanding the Store Environment
• Marketing & PR for Fashion Retail
• Key Skills Level 2 for Communications, Application of Number and ICT for students who have not gained GCSE Maths, English or ICT at C grade or above.

What’s next after a Level 2 Diploma?
Students completing the Level 2 Diploma course have progressed to further study both within the
Fashion Retail Academy and elsewhere, whilst others have secured supervisory roles in fashion retail stores. The type of employment role may vary depending on the size of store you are successful in joining.
